The One Shot meta is back in Fortnite thanks to a new weapon

Fortnite just added a brand new weapon from the recent update, which has many players worried due to the amount of damage it deals.

Fortnite's meta is constantly evolving, as the game often rolls out updates that shake up the weapon loot pool in addition to adding new ones. In Chapter 5 Season 3 alone, we saw the vehicle meta surface in Battle Royale thanks to the addition of Mythic Nitro Cars and countless vehicle mods.

But with the recent nerfs, combined with the new weapons added since the last update, some players are convinced that a “boring” old meta is back. This is mainly due to the addition of the all-new Heavy Impact Sniper weapon, which allows you to one-shot your enemies.

The Heavy Impact Sniper was just added yesterday, but in a Reddit thread featuring a snippet of what the sniper is capable of, some players couldn't help but express their concern.

The clip shows that the Heavy Impact Sniper can instantly kill an enemy as soon as it pops its head, reminding many players of what the old feared sniper meta was like.

Sure, the weapon has its downsides – like slow reloading and significant bullet drop that makes it extremely punishing if you miss – but in the hands of an experienced player or cheater, it can be a nightmare to manage.

One user wrote: “I was happy when they removed the 1 shot snipers, now I have to deal with them again? »

“This season is just about pissing everyone off, huh? They finally make it so that cars don't get broken absurdly, then they make it so that you can instantly die at any distance, with the only counterplay being having a car so they can't not bump into you,” another user said.

“Just when I thought we'd have a season WITHOUT a broken sniper rifle, wow, I'm such an idiot,” another user added. Meanwhile, one user claimed that one shots in Fortnite are “boring as hell” because there's no time to react.

As with any other weapon, there is always a chance that this sniper will receive balance changes. However, players will just have to be patient for now to see what the next update has in store for them.
